# gstreamer uyvy camera stream not working on voxl2

Source: https://forum.modalai.com/topic/4001/gstreamer-uyvy-camera-stream-not-working-on-voxl2
Category: VOXL SDK and Software (https://forum.modalai.com/category/47/voxl-sdk-and-software)
Posted: 2024-12-05 00:45:17 UTC by Samuel Lehman
Replies: 4 · Views: 3647

## Samuel Lehman · 2024-12-05 00:45:17 UTC

Hello, I have been trying to use gstreamer to stream video from a usb camera that outputs uyvy but I have been unsuccessful. I am connected to the same network as the voxl2 and I am interacting with it through ssh. Running the following command 
```
gst-launch-1.0 v4l2src device=/dev/video2 ! video/x-raw,format=UYVY ! videoconvert ! x264enc ! rtph264pay name=pay0 ! udpsink host=192.168.0.149 port=8554

```
on the voxl2 and 
```
gst-launch-1.0  udpsrc port=8554 caps = "application/x-rtp, media=(string)video, clock-rate=(int)90000, encoding-name=(string)H264, payload=(int)96" ! rtph264depay ! decodebin ! videoconvert  ! autovideosink
```
on my host machine results in the gstreamer on the voxl2 doing nothing and then eventually crashing.

## Reply by cegeyer · 2024-12-05 18:32:59 UTC

Try to run this command on the VOXL-2 and see if it outputs anything when streaming from the host to make sure you actually are getting data into the VOXL:
```
gst-launch-1.0 udpsrc port=8554 num-buffers=1 ! fakesink dump=true
```
I also have issues with `decodebin` receiving an h264 stream as it uses `qtivdec` to decode the h264 and outputs `video/x-raw(memory:GBM)` which I have issues working with. You can try this pipeline to use a different decoder:
```
gst-launch-1.0  udpsrc port=8554 caps = "application/x-rtp, media=(string)video, clock-rate=(int)90000, encoding-name=(string)H264, payload=(int)96" ! rtph264depay ! h264parse ! omxh264dec ! videoconvert ! autovideosink sync=false
```

## Reply by cegeyer · 2024-12-06 18:19:38 UTC

How are you logged into the VOXL to get the window? I was able to get it by running `ssh -X root@<VOXL IP>` from a Linxu host were I was logged in with a display.  I don't have any peripheral to get a display directly from the VOXL.

You can test my method by connecting to the VOXL via `ssh -X` then running this `gst-launch-1.0 videotestsrc ! autovideosink`. You should see a window pop up with a test pattern.

Hopefully that fixes the issue, if not, you can try to switch `omxh264dec` with `avdec_h264` but it will then use CPU instead of GPU

## Reply by Alex Kushleyev (ModalAI staff) · 2024-12-06 18:56:31 UTC (in reply to cegeyer)

@cegeyer 

Here is a command to stream video from VOXL2 camera via ssh X forwading. FPS may be limited due to bandwidth (perhaps this is the command you meant in your reference above).

```
ssh -X root@<voxl-ip>
gst-launch-1.0 qtiqmmfsrc camera=0 ! "video/x-raw, width=1280,height=720,framerate=30/1" ! autovideoconvert ! autovideosink
```

This should pop up a window with the stream from the camera. Make sure `voxl-camera-server` is not running if you are testing one of the mipi cameras connected to voxl2.
